This collection of notes and essays on his world travels reveals a man bursting with self-deprecating wit, keen observational powers, and an intelligent awareness of his own cultural biases and prejudices. First published in 1899, this volume serves as a delightful reminder of Kipling's genius, and includes: an account of attending the theater in Japan and visiting Shinto shrines; an exploration of India's \"city of elephants\" and a meeting with \"the naughty children of Iquique\"; notes on a journey to San Francisco and the taking of tea with the \"natives\" there; an explanation of how to \"manufacture ethnological theories at railroad speed\"; and much more.","brand":"Doubleday \u0026 McClure Company","offers":[{"title":"Default Title","offer_id":40398861074502,"sku":"2329333","price":40.0,"currency_code":"USD","in_stock":false}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/1232\/9510\/products\/2329333.jpg?v=1668118791","url":"https:\/\/ym-demo.myshopify.com\/products\/from-sea-to-sea-letters-of-travel-in-two-volumes","provider":"Yesterday's Muse","version":"1.0","type":"link"}
